Since when does Suspend care if it is a creature SPELL? Also, SPELLS can't gain haste or other abilities, at least currently.
It has cared all along. The comp rules specifically say that suspend grants haste only to creatures. If the thing didn't come into play as a creature, no haste.
This is counter-intuitive in many ways, I must say, but I guess they just did this to get rid of the confusion that will ensue if they used "Permanents played this way have haste."
Personally, I'd prefer that, though. I want my totem to attack, dammit!

That's the point -- I said it gets haste if it CIPs as critter, he said, only if it was a critter SPELL. I asked, since when it cared if it was a critter SPELL. That is, only that it becomes a critter PERMANENT
That's the point -- I said it gets haste if it CIPs as critter, he said, only if it was a critter SPELL. I asked, since when it cared if it was a critter SPELL. That is, only that it becomes a critter PERMANENT
Comprehensive rules:
"If you play a creature spell this way, it gains haste until you lose control of the spell or the permanent it becomes."
